Detailed Comparison

Fee Comparison

Pepperstone: Razor account: from 0.0 pip + €2.60 commission/lot, Standard: from 1.0 pip. Minimum deposit: 0 €.

XTB: 0% commission on stock CFDs (up to €100,000/month), spreads from 0.1 pip. Minimum deposit: 0 €.

Regulation & Security

Pepperstone is regulated by BaFin/FCA/ASIC (HQ: Melbourne).

XTB is regulated by KNF/FCA/CySEC (HQ: Warsaw).
